“Auralspace Divine” is the debut solo release of Line Noise on Boltfish (Sep 2005). As far as releases in general go Line Noise is far from being a newcomer though, a quick count on affiliated netlabel Lacedmilk Technologies alone ends at six album releases and that’s not counting collaborations and aliases.
